the arrangement because P.C. Yeung Fat was cheating him, and he arranged for the money to be paid to P.S. 190 Tang Chung.

The money used to be paid to No. 9 Circular Pathway (Fang Chung's Club). Tang Chung asked me to go there and fetch it once a week for P.S. 43 Holt as Tang Chung had not time to get it.

After the beginning of the Chinese New Year, I went regularly once a week to No. 9 Circular Pathway and fetched $10.50/100 for Holt. The money used to be done up in a parcel. I used to receive it from Tang Chung's own hands. I used to pay it to P.S. 43 Holt either in the street, or early in the morning in the Central Station when the detectives met to get their instructions.

I received the bribes for P.S. 43 Holt and paid them to him for 8 weeks. After that, Tang Chung told me that I need not come for the money as he would pay it himself to the Sergeant.

Tang Chung told me that as he was paying No. 3 McIver, he could pay the money to Holt at the same time.

I know that Stanton, Quincey, and Baker all received bribes from Sam Yin in respect of the Fa Lane gambling house. E.S. 190 Fang Chung has told me so.
